Where To Find TGPX?
 
I installed the free version of Smart Thumbs because it comes compatible with mobile devices and then I realized that it does updates on clicks and not on daily basis as I want.

Where is the best place to download TGPX? What version of PHP should I run it under? I see a couple of repos and not sure which one to use.

If you know, sharing it would be appreciated. Thanks! |thumb

Toby 2018-02-18 10:32 AM

JMB closed up shop a number of years ago, but did so in a friendly manner and made the code open source. It has since been updated infrequently by the community, most recently in January 2015. It is compatible with PHP 5.5.

https://github.com/rjkmelb/TGPX-Updated

Toby 2018-02-18 02:35 PM

I'm still using the pre open source JMB version, single site x 7, not the multi-site GitHub version. I'm also running PHP 5.2 in order to be able to do so. The functionality is pretty much the same, but there are a few differences.
